Construction on Dual-Branded Marriott Hotel in Old UNO Building to Begin Soon

It should be complete by mid-2017

The plan to convert an old University of New Orleans building on Canal Street downtown into a pair of Marriott Hotels should be underway soon; the hotel's developers have filed renovation permit applications with the city.

Dallas developer NewcrestImage is turning the 13-story vacant office building into a 105-room TownePlace Suites by Marriott and a 78-room SpringHill Suites by Marriott.

The two hotels—SpringHill caters to leisure and business travelers, TownePlace would be an extended stay hotel—would share amenities, including a rooftop with an "8,000-square-foot garden overlooking Canal Street with an outdoor bar, exercise room, guest laundry area and penthouse area."

The developers expect to receive the renovation permit within the next 60 days and construction would begin soon after that. The hotels are slated to be complete "sometime in mid-2017."
